Prep boys basketball: State Farm City of Palms Classic releases full field The 38th annual City of Palms Classic has a new title sponsor (State Farm) and one of the strongest holiday tournament fields in high school basketball history, rivaling the 2008 group that included the recent NBA Draft’s No. 1 selection (John Wall), eight McDonald’s All-Americans as seniors and six of USA Today’s top eight preseason teams.

USDA program to aid water quality Two northeastern Louisiana watersheds are included in an $80 million, 12-state initiative to improve water quality in the Mississippi River Basin by managing fertilizer and sediment runoff from agricultural land.
